Monoclonal antibody for identification of Bacteroides gingivalis lipopolysaccharide.

S J Millar1, P B Chen, E Hausmann.   

Abstract

A monoclonal antibody, BBG-25, raised in BALB/c mice demonstrated specificity for Bacteroides gingivalis lipopolysaccharide. Immunoblotting indicated that this monoclonal antibody does not cross-react with lipopolysaccharide prepared from enterobacterial organisms or from other Bacteroides species.
